• 410 Views
  • 7 Min Read
  • 2 years ago

The decentralized web, or Web 3.0, seeks to build a safe internet by utilizing autonomous technology. Decentralized infrastructure, which serves as the basis for decentralized applications (dApps) and decentralized autonomous organizations (DAOs), is a critical component of this strategy. Substrate and Cosmos are two systems and platforms that are assisting in allowing the decentralized internet.

This article will look at two distinct decentralized infrastructures, compare their important characteristics, and analyze their possible applications on the decentralized web. Let's start.

Cosmos Blockchain

Cosmos builds a decentralized network of separate blockchains that are scalable and interoperable. It is a layer 0 blockchain intended to make it possible to build safe, scalable, and adaptable blockchain applications, emphasizing facilitating interoperability across other blockchain systems.

Features of Cosmos Blockchain

Modular Design

The modular structure of Cosmos makes it simple for developers to create and modify their blockchain apps.

Interoperability Support

The Cosmos blockchain enables communication across several blockchain networks. The Interchain Communication Protocol (ICP), a set of tools and protocols, facilitates asset exchange and cross-chain communication between Cosmos-based networks and other blockchain systems.

Decentralized Governance Model

Stakeholders can vote on network improvements and updates with Cosmos' decentralized governance approach. This also makes it possible for the network to change and adapt decentralized and transparently.

To sum up, the Cosmos platform provides a reliable, adaptable framework for creating and implementing decentralized networks and applications.

Substrate Framework

The substrate is an open-source platform that supports the development of decentralized networks and applications.

Features of Substrate Blockchain

Modular Design

The substrate is modular in design, allowing developers to quickly alter and expand the framework to meet their individual needs. It offers a pluggable design allowing developers to add or remove functionality as needed, such as consensus methods and on-chain governance.

Smart Contract Support

Polkadot Runtime Environment (PRE), a smart contract language embedded into Substrate, enables developers to build and deploy smart contracts on Substrate-based networks.

Strong Interoperability

It is simple for Substrate-based networks to exchange data and assets with other blockchain systems because of Substrate's support for cross-chain communication and ability to link to other blockchain networks.

Last but not least, the Substrate framework provides a robust and adaptable architecture for creating decentralized networks and applications.

Differences Between Substrate and Cosmos

Substrate and Cosmos are both robust and adaptable decentralized infrastructure projects that are assisting in developing the decentralized web. Despite their similarities, they have several key distinctions that developers should consider when selecting a platform for creating decentralized apps and networks.

Support for Several Blockchain Types

Cosmos blockchain focuses on creating a decentralized network of independent blockchains, whereas Substrate blockchain concentrates on creating Polkadot-based networks.

Governance Models

The substrate features a more centralized governance approach, with a foundation in charge of framework maintenance and development. Conversely, Cosmos provides a decentralized governance mechanism that allows stakeholders to vote on network updates and improvements.

Conclusion

To sum up, the decentralized web movement is expanding quickly, and we anticipate that its supporters will release additional technologies in the next years. Decentralized infrastructure is also a crucial element of the decentralized web, providing the framework for creating dApps and administrating organizations. Cosmos and Substrate are two significant blockchains that provide stable and adaptable building blocks for developing decentralized networks and applications.

Want to create a blockchain using Substrate or Cosmos? Let’s chat with our experts.

 

👋 Hi there! Let's Chat. 🤗